SemiAnalysis: AI infrastructure buildout caps wafer supply, depressing CapEx

The AI infrastructure buildout is impacting the semiconductor market, with average selling prices (ASPs) showing signs of increasing after a period of depression. Major wafer manufacturers have tightened capital expenditures, with 2026 projections significantly lower than the 2023 peak. This reduced supply, driven by demand for leading-edge logic and High Bandwidth Memory (HBM), is expected to continue through 2027 due to existing long-term agreements. AI

    Supply is capped near-term. CapEx has tightened at the 4 Major Wafer Makers. CY26 CapEx is ~70% below the peak in 2023 and is expected to stay depressed.

    Supply is capped near-term. CapEx has tightened at the 4 Major Wafer Makers. CY26 CapEx is ~70% below the peak in 2023 and is expected to stay depressed. These silicon suppliers won't budge on CapEx until they have customer commitments to help fund it! Key wafer fab equipment, ht…
